Leicester City set a Premier League mark tonight while equaling another one in a 9-0 clowning of Southampton from St. Mary’s.

The tally was set a new mark for the largest road win the EPL has ever witnessed while the Fox’s also equaled the largest win in Premier League history.

Leicester City took advantage of a red card issued to Ryan Bertrand in the 12β€² and held a 5-0 lead at the half. The Fox’s, however, continued to pile on the Saints in the second half as Ayoze Perez completed his hat trick in the 57β€² while Jamie Vardy netted his in the 90β€² +4β€² off a penalty.

The win sent Leicester into second in the Premier League table while further sending a message to the rest of the League. Meanwhile, this loss will surely haunt Southampton for years to come as move into the relegation zone ahead of the weekend’s matchups.
